Prince of the musical world Ikusaburo Yamazaki, who always entertains viewers with various performances at SONGS, will appear for the fourth time in about a year!
This time, Ikusaburo Yamazaki will be giving a harmony course to Hiroshi Oizumi, who has just started his career as a singer.
He taught Hiroshi Oizumi the charm and tips of harmonization. Will Oizumi be able to show off her beautiful harmony in Chiharu Matsuyama’s famous song “Oozora to Daichi no Nakade”? ?

In addition, the SONGS playlist selects Masashi Sada’s famous song “Reason of Life”. Having started a family and becoming a father, the episode of the song that touched his heart once again developed into a father talk with Hiroshi Oizumi.
We bring you a valuable talk from Papa Ikusaburo Yamazaki, who is a little different from Prince Ikusaburo Yamazaki.

Furthermore, on the topic of their latest album, they talked about a new attempt to depict a single story through a single album. Therein lies Ikusaburo Yamazaki’s desire to create a musical originating from Japan…
Ikusaburo Yamazaki, who has steadily built a career in the musical world, talks about the future he has in mind.
